Transcribed Image Text:### Educational Resource on PCBs and Confidence Intervals
**Topic**: Polychlorinated Biphenyls (PCBs) and Statistical Analysis
**Overview**:
Polychlorinated biphenyls (PCBs) are synthetic chemicals previously used in electrical equipment for insulation. They became a health concern and were banned in the 1970s due to their release into rivers and subsequent environmental impact.
**Scenario**:
To estimate the concentration of PCBs in a river, a study is conducted:
- **Sample Size**: 60 water samples
- **Sample Mean**: 1.96 parts per billion (ppb)
- **Population Standard Deviation**: 0.36 ppb
**Task**:
Construct a 95% confidence interval to estimate the true mean PCB concentration in the river.
**Options for Confidence Interval**:
1. \(1.948 < \mu < 1.972\)
2. \(1.869 < \mu < 2.051\)
3. \(0.269 < \mu < 0.451\)
The goal is to determine which interval correctly represents the 95% confidence interval for the true mean PCB concentration based on the given data.
